The Business Management and Administration Top-Up course is designed for students holding an HND, Foundation Degree, or equivalent in the business area, aiming to progress to a full honours degree. It combines essential knowledge with academic skills development, providing a pathway from your previous studies to degree success. The course is taught at Queen’s Park, Chester, by both academics and practitioners to ensure a balance of theory and real-world application. It emphasizes developing strategic, leadership, and professional skills relevant to business management, with access to specialist tutor support. The taught modules focus on areas like strategic management, leadership and change, international financial management, and international marketing, offering broad and applied learning within a well-supported environment.

Applicants need a Level 5 related qualification, such as an HND or Foundation Degree in a business-related field. International students should have qualifications roughly equivalent to UK A Levels, along with English language proficiency: IELTS Academic with a minimum score of 6.0 overall (5.5 in each band) for undergraduates or 6.5 (5.5 in each band) for postgraduate courses.

Graduates are prepared for a variety of roles across business sectors, including HR, marketing, operations, and management. The course also serves as a stepping stone for postgraduate business studies. The university’s careers service offers support through employer engagement, internships, CV workshops, and interview preparation, helping students leverage their skills for their desired career paths.
